Hawzah News Agency - (Mashhad - Iran) - Sheikh Zakzaky’s endeavors and sacrifices to promote Islam is worth introducing him as a model for the Islamic society, said Hoj. Ahmad Marvi, Astan Quds Razavi’s chief custodian in a meeting with Sheikh’s daughters at Imam Reza (AS) holy shrine.

Briefed by the family of Zakzaky over his health, Hoj. Marvi said: “The question of Zakzaky is a main concern for the Islamic Republic of Iran and Leader Ayatollah Khamenei”.

Highlighting Zakzaky’s influence on African nations, Marvi said: “Sheikh did a great job in Africa and could teach tens of thousands there; that’s why Islam’s enemies attacked him and his followers”.

He added: “Zakzaky’s revolutionary ideology cannot be destroyed. Foes are so stupid to think that killing of influential leaders will finish their path as Yazid thought that martyring Imam Hussein (AS) and his companions would be the end of Villayat and Imamate school of thought”.

Referring to him as the ‘Khomeini of Africa’, Marvi remarked: “Sheikh Zakzaky did a lot of great job for Islam and his endeavors and sacrifices can be a real model for the freedom seekers in the world; the thought Zakzaky triggered in Africa is flourishing day by day”. 

The Nigerian Shia cleric, Sheikh Zakzaky, and his family have endured lots of afflictions. Six of his sons were killed by the army forces, and the Sheikh himself is in a tyrannous arrest now.

Elsewhere, AQR chief custodian stressed: “AQR will do its best to introduce Sheikh to the world as it recognizes him as an excellent model for the youths, clerics and the entire society. Imam Reza (AS) holy shrine establishment will also take its greatest efforts to get Razavi pilgrims familiar with Sheikh Zakzaky’s character and thoughts”.
